I can hear the laptop works but nothing shows on display

Hello, I have am Acer Aspire 5740G and when I power on the laptop I can hear it work but it doesn’t show anything on the display. I connected the laptop with hdmi on my monitor and the monither show “No signal”. Is there any way to check if the problem is from GPU or from Screen?

Hi,

Just checking that you pressed Fn +F5 to toggle the display between the internal, external and both screens on together to see if you get a display anywhere?

If you don't get a display at all, then you have a GPU or motherboard problem

Hi,

OK

Same deal with display or not in BIOS

If there is a display in BIOS try starting the laptop in safe mode and check if the display works.

If it does you have a driver problem or startup problem.

If there is no display in BIOS or safe mode here's a link to a video so that you can check the LVDS cable connections etc, as per the other answer

Hi, the problem could be maybe that the RAM modules are dirty, so you should clean the gold bars with an eraser carefully, and then connect it again, if it doesn’t work, try blowing the sockets .
